About Blast from the Past Car Show and Drag Races
Blast from the Past is a three-day car show and drag racing weekend organized by the Helena Valley Timing Association, a nonprofit car club. It started in 2006 and had reached its 19th annual running by 2024. The event brings in more than 400 cars from around the country. All proceeds fund scholarships for students pursuing automotive trades education; the club says it has raised over $120,000 for scholarships across the event's history.
The weekend splits across two sites. The car show, a judged 'Show 'n Shine' display, runs Saturday at the Broadwater Grounds on Highway 12 West. The drag races run Sunday at the Rocky Mountain Fire Training Center near Helena Regional Airport, with sheriff's-office and fire-crew support. Friday night kicks the weekend off with a party featuring live music and a flame-thrower contest. Car display entry runs $20; spectator admission is set separately by the club each year.
